How Ignition Coil Is Connected To The Distributor. The ignition coil is the part of your engine that produces high voltage in order to power your cylinders. The ignition coil is usually mounted on the engine or the firewall, while the distributor is connected to the engine and has multiple wires leading to the. The points, also known as the contact points or breaker points, are mechanical components that open and close to control the flow of electricity through the ignition coil. When the ignition key is turned on, a low voltage current from the battery flows through the primary windings of the ignition coil, through the breaker points and back to the battery.
